#0b3c89 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0b3c89 is composed of 4.3% red, 23.5%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92% cyan, 56.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 216.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 29%. #0b3c89 color hex could be obtained by blending #1678ff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#0b3c89

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01040a is the darkest color, while #f7fafe is the lightest one.
